Publication number: 20230232937Abstract: Provided are, among other things, systems, methods and techniques for making a shoe outsole and to shoe outsoles made using such techniques. In one such technique, a sheet of composite material is produced by extruding a base material together with a sheet of fabric material. The sheet of composite material is then cut into an outsole component, and a shoe outsole is fabricated using the outsole component.Type: ApplicationFiled: April 5, 2023Publication date: July 27, 2023Inventors: John Koo, Jonathan Goldberg

Patent number: 10285968Abstract: The present disclosure relates to drug eluting devices, and their uses. The drug eluting devices can allow for perfusion during deployment. The coatings the may contain bioactive materials which elute once deployed in a patient and can have anti-proliferative, anti-inflammation, or anti-thrombotic effects. Sol gel technology can be used to coat the devices.Type: GrantFiled: March 13, 2018Date of Patent: May 14, 2019Assignee: CELONOVA BIOSCIENCES, INC.Inventors: Richard Klein, John Birtles, John Koos, Michael J. Lee

Publication number: 20170216618Abstract: A method for testing diseased skin for treatment of the diseased skin, comprising the steps of administering a plurality of increasing doses of phototherapy directly to regions of an area of diseased skin and analyzing the area of the diseased skin to assess the doses at which burning and blistering of the diseased skin occurs, determining a maximum dose of phototherapy that can be administered to the diseased skin based on the assessment of the doses at which the burning and the blistering of the diseased skin occurs, and treating the diseased skin.Type: ApplicationFiled: October 3, 2014Publication date: August 3, 2017Inventors: John KOO, Maya DEBBANEH, Ethan LEVIN

Publication number: 20160237766Abstract: A riser tensioner system and a wellbay structure for a floating unit or platform for deep/ultra-deep water field development. The riser tensioner system includes a first cassette, a second cassette, a tension joint, one or more centralizers, and a plurality of cylinders. The one or more centralizers provide lateral support to the tension joint. Each of the plurality of cylinders comprises a first end, a second end, and an intermediate portion. The first end of each of the plurality of cylinders is secured to the first cassette, and an intermediate portion of each of the plurality of cylinders is secured to the second cassette. The wellbay structure includes a plurality of transverse girders and a plurality of longitudinal girders. The girders form a grid comprising a plurality of slots. Each of the plurality of slots is configured for receiving and supporting a first cassette of each a riser tensioner assembly.Type: ApplicationFiled: February 12, 2016Publication date: August 18, 2016Inventors: Yijian Zeng, Dale Smith, John Koos

Patent number: 9023392Abstract: Methods for administering a dermatological agent to a subject are provided. In the subject methods an effective amount of a topical formulation of the dermatological agent is topically applied to a host. The topically applied formulation of dermatological agent is then occluded with a hydrogel patch, where a feature of the hydrogel patch is that it lacks a pharmaceutically active agent. Also provided are methods of treating a subject for a disease condition by administering a dermatological agent to the subject. Also provided are kits for use in practicing the subject methods. The subject methods and compositions find use in a variety of different applications.Type: GrantFiled: December 27, 2012Date of Patent: May 5, 2015Assignees: Teikoku Pharma USA, Inc., Teikoku Seiyaku Kabushiki KaishaInventors: John Koo, Jutaro Shudo, Sadanobu Shirai

Patent number: 8661713Abstract: Provided is a shoe outsole and/or a sheet material which can be used to fabricate such an outsole (among other things), formed of a base material that includes a number of indentations and lower-extending portions. Small particles are bonded to at least some of the indentations, but the lower-extending portions predominantly are uncoated with such small particles. Also provided are methods and techniques for manufacturing such outsoles and sheet material, as well as shoes incorporating such outsoles.Type: GrantFiled: September 8, 2006Date of Patent: March 4, 2014Assignee: Dynasty Footwear, Ltd.Inventors: John Koo, Jonathan Goldberg
